Gerald Schermann is a scholar working on Information Systems, Computer Networks and Communications and Software. According to data from OpenAlex, Gerald Schermann has authored 15 papers receiving a total of 332 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Information Systems, 10 papers in Computer Networks and Communications and 5 papers in Software. Recurrent topics in Gerald Schermann's work include Software System Performance and Reliability (10 papers), Software Engineering Research (6 papers) and Software Engineering Techniques and Practices (6 papers). Gerald Schermann is often cited by papers focused on Software System Performance and Reliability (10 papers), Software Engineering Research (6 papers) and Software Engineering Techniques and Practices (6 papers). Gerald Schermann collaborates with scholars based in Switzerland, Austria and Sweden. Gerald Schermann's co-authors include Philipp Leitner, Jürgen Cito, Harald C. Gall, Uwe Zdun, Sebastiano Panichella, Daniele Romano, Carmine Vassallo, Massimiliano Di Penta, Fiorella Zampetti and Andy Zaidman and has published in prestigious journals such as IEEE Software, Information and Software Technology and Zurich Open Repository and Archive (University of Zurich).
